Public config Command#

Observation:

  • codealmanac --help exposes config.
  • README.md documents codealmanac config set auto_commit false.
  • Tests cover codealmanac config set.
  • docs/python-port-live-agreement.md also contains an older line saying not to add a public config command until a later agreement requires it.

Architectural cost:

The config service is legitimate either way, but a public config command adds parser, dispatch, rendering, tests, and user-facing support burden.

Question:

Is the narrow public config set surface now an intentional product decision, or did it slip in because setup needed a way to persist auto_commit?

Current refactor stance:

Preserve behavior. Treat the contradictory live-agreement line as stale until Rohan decides otherwise.

Setup Raw Terminal Choice UI#

Observation:

  • cli/dispatch/setup_tui.py and cli/render/setup.py implement an interactive raw-mode setup choice flow.
  • The terminal output and cards are rich product polish, but they add a lot of bespoke rendering mechanics.

Architectural cost:

The CLI now owns a mini terminal UI system, not just command output rendering.

Question:

Is raw-mode interactive setup a core product requirement, or would plain flags plus polished noninteractive output be enough?

Current refactor stance:

Preserve behavior and isolate the machinery so it does not spread.

Setup Default Auto-Update#

Observation:

  • The live agreement says plain setup --yes installs sync, Garden, and daily update automation.
  • Scheduled update has lock, editable-install detection, active-run checks, and post-update smoke checks.

Architectural cost:

Auto-update creates global locking, package-manager detection, scheduler commands, install-method support, and smoke-check behavior.

Question:

Is default scheduled product update essential for v1 trust, or should it be an explicit opt-in because package self-mutation is a large support surface?

Current refactor stance:

Preserve behavior. Keep update automation as an explicit service boundary.

Full Uninstall Removes The Installed Tool#

Observation:

  • The live agreement says uninstall removes CodeAlmanac-owned instructions, automation, global state, and the installed binary when supported.

Architectural cost:

Self-uninstall requires package-manager detection and command execution from inside the tool that may remove itself.

Question:

Is binary removal part of the product promise, or should uninstall mean "remove CodeAlmanac local state and agent hooks" while package managers own the installed executable?

Current refactor stance:

Preserve behavior. Keep package uninstall behind the setup service port.

build As A Lifecycle Operation#

Observation:

  • build appears beside ingest and garden as an AI page-writing workflow.
  • init also exists as a non-AI wiki bootstrap command.

Architectural cost:

The distinction is clear after reading docs, but the product words are close: one initializes the tree, the other asks an agent to build wiki content.

Question:

Is build the right public word, or does it invite confusion with package builds and index rebuilds?

Current refactor stance:

Preserve behavior and names. Improve internal boundaries only.
